NYCN Declares Emergency, Moves HQ to FUOYE Campus


The Ekiti State chapter of the National Youth Council of Nigeria (NYCN) has declared a state of emergency at the Federal University Oye-Ekiti (FUOYE), citing widespread corruption and moral decay in the institution.


In a letter dated October 29, 2025, and signed by Chairman Amb. James Bankole and Secretary Silas Olawale, the council said it had exhausted all official channels, including petitions to the presidency, ministries, and anti-corruption agencies.


Effective November 3, 2025, the NYCN announced plans to relocate its operational headquarters to FUOYE’s main campus and commence daily peaceful protests until its demands are met.


The group is calling for the suspension of Vice-Chancellor Prof. Abayomi Fasina, the removal of Governing Council Chairman Senator Victor Ndoma-Egba, the investigation and prosecution of sexual abuse cases, the suspension of the ongoing vice-chancellorship selection, and a forensic audit of the university’s finances since 2021.


The NYCN also urged students, youth groups, and civil society organisations to join the campaign to “liberate FUOYE from corruption, abuse of office, and declining moral standards.”
